Factors to Consider When Choosing a backpack running work

The right commuter pack should support movement without sacrificing daily storage. Focus on fit, capacity, hydration, ventilation, and maintenance before choosing. These factors help match each design with your route and routine.

Secure Fit During Movement

A stable fit keeps shoulder straps from bouncing during faster commutes.

Look for adjustable chest and shoulder straps that sit comfortably.

Storage Capacity

Choose capacity according to clothing, electronics, toiletries, and daily work supplies.

Compact packs suit light loads, while larger bags handle clothing changes.

Hydration Access

Hydration storage helps runners drink without stopping beside busy roads.

Check bladder size, tube placement, filling access, and cleaning requirements.

Ventilation And Comfort

Breathable shoulder materials can reduce sweat buildup during warm commutes.

Back padding should feel supportive without creating excessive heat.

Weather Protection

Water-resistant fabric helps protect clothing and electronics during unexpected showers.

Remember that water resistance does not always mean complete waterproof protection.

Daily Maintenance

Hydration bladders need regular rinsing, drying, and careful storage between uses.

Wide openings simplify cleaning and help reduce lingering odors.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can a running backpack hold work clothing?

Yes, larger designs can carry folded clothing, toiletries, and small accessories.

Compact vests usually suit commuters carrying minimal workplace essentials.

How should a running backpack fit?

Adjust the shoulder and chest straps until movement feels controlled.

The pack should remain close without restricting breathing or arm movement.

Are hydration bladders useful for commuting?

Hydration bladders provide convenient drinking access during longer routes.

They require regular cleaning and complete drying after each use.

Can these backpacks work for cycling?

Many running-focused packs also suit cycling, hiking, and walking.

Check stability, visibility features, and storage before changing activities.

How can runners reduce bouncing?

Use the sternum strap and tighten shoulder adjustments before starting.

Distribute heavier items close to your back for improved stability.

What should commuters carry inside?

Carry only essentials, including clothing, identification, keys, and hydration.

Extra items increase movement and can make running less comfortable.
